Abstract
Oxidation of CH4 under lean condition ((8) over bar 00 ppm) and CO2 reformi ng of CH4 were carried out using Rh/ZrO2 catalysts with different metal dis persions. It was found that both reactions showed a similar structure-sensi tive behavior: The TOF decreased with increasing of Rh dispersion. It is su ggested that the rate determining step is dissociative adsorption of CH4 or both reactions, and strong Rh-O bonds in smaller Rh crystallites may lead to a suppression of the dissociative adsorption of CH4 on the Rh surface.
